微舆系统架构深度解析:多智能体协同工作的核心机制
微舆系统是一个从0实现的创新型多智能体舆情分析系统,帮助用户全面了解信息,还原舆情原貌,把握舆情趋势,辅助决策。这个系统采用独特的论坛协作机制,让多个专业AI智能体像人类专家一样进行辩论和交流,最终生成高质量的舆情分析内容。🚀
🌟 系统核心架构揭秘
微舆系统的核心采用多智能体协同工作模式,通过五个专业Agent分工协作,实现对30+主流社媒平台的全方位舆情监控。
如图所示,系统包含五个核心引擎:
- QueryEngine - 精准信息搜索Agent
- MediaEngine - 多模态内容分析Agent
- InsightEngine - 私有数据库挖掘Agent
- ReportEngine - 智能内容生成Agent
- ForumEngine - 论坛协作管理引擎
🔍 多智能体协同工作机制
微舆系统最独特的设计在于其论坛协作机制。当用户提出分析需求后,系统会启动以下流程:
1. 并行启动阶段
三个核心Agent(Query、Media、Insight)同时开始工作,各自使用专属工具进行概览搜索。
2. 深度研究循环
- 各Agent基于论坛主持人引导进行专项搜索
- ForumEngine监控Agent发言并生成主持人总结
- 各Agent根据讨论调整研究方向
3. 结果整合与内容生成
Report Agent收集所有分析结果和论坛内容,动态选择模板和样式,多轮生成最终内容。
🛠️ 核心模块详解
QueryEngine智能体
位于QueryEngine/agent.py的核心Agent负责国内外新闻的广度搜索。
MediaEngine多模态分析
具备强大的多模态理解能力,能够深度解析抖音、快手等短视频内容。
InsightEngine数据库挖掘
通过InsightEngine/tools/search.py实现对私有舆情数据库的深度分析。
💡 技术亮点与创新
1. 超越单一LLM的复合分析
系统不仅依赖5类专业Agent,更融合了微调模型、统计模型等中间件,确保分析结果的深度和准确性。
2. Agent"论坛"协作机制
为不同Agent赋予独特的工具集与思维模式,引入辩论主持人模型,通过"论坛"机制进行链式思维碰撞。
3. 公私域数据无缝融合
平台不仅分析公开舆情,还提供高安全性接口,支持内部业务数据库与舆情数据的无缝集成。
📊 实际应用场景
系统已成功应用于多个实际案例,如"武汉大学舆情"分析,生成的分析内容位于final_reports/final_report__20250827_131630.html。
🔧 快速部署指南
系统支持一键式Docker部署:
docker compose up -d
访问 http://localhost:5000 即可使用完整系统功能。
🚀 未来发展方向
微舆系统将继续完善趋势分析功能,运用时序模型、图神经网络、多模态融合等分析模型技术,实现真正基于数据驱动的舆情趋势分析。
通过这种创新的多智能体协同工作架构,微舆系统能够提供远超传统舆情工具的深度分析能力,成为驱动业务决策的强大数据分析引擎。✨
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考





